How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Gladstone?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gladstone Studio Apartments | $1,448 | $955 | $2,000 |
| Gladstone 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,504 | $600 | $2,600 |
| Gladstone 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,521 | $600 | $3,200 |
| Gladstone 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,366 | $1,650 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gladstone
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Gladstone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Gladstone ranges from $600 to $2,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,504.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Gladstone c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Gladstone range from $600 to $3,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,521.
How expensive are Gladstone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 15 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Gladstone on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,650 to $3,600 - averaging $2,366 for the location.
